How many rounds can a 300 Win Mag shoot?

30/06 is 3,000 to 4,000 rounds of first-class accuracy, depending on how it’s shot. Since the . 300 Win Mag has the same bore diameter but holds substantially more powder, I’d say it’s good for 2,500 to 3,000 rounds. Either way, that’s a lot of shooting, and very few hunters will burn out a barrel for either cartridge.

What is the best load for 300 Win Mag?

For shooting elk or similar sized critters a 160 to 180 grain bullet is just about ideal. A popular long range load for the 300 Win Mag near this range is the 190 grain Berger VLD. The 7mm counterpart is the 180 grain Berger VLD. In the standard Gunwerks loads these two bullets have identical muzzle velocities.

How many yards is a 300 Win Mag good for?

The . 300 Win Mag sees use in long-range benchrest shooting competitions and has been adopted by law enforcement marksmen and by a few specific branches of the U.S. Military for use by snipers. Maximum effective range is generally accepted to be 1,210 yards (1,110 m) with ammunition incorporating low-drag projectiles.

How hard does a 300 Win Mag kick?

300 Winchester delivers about 30.5 foot-pounds of recoil. A same-weight . 30-06 dishes out roughly 22 foot-pounds.

What is more powerful 7mm mag or 300 Win Mag?

From the muzzle out to 300 yards, all of the . 300 Win Mag rounds show higher bullet energy than the 7mm Rem Mag rounds. Right from the muzzle, the lowest . 300 Win Mag round is carrying 3,474ft.lb of force while the highest 7mm Rem Mag round is carrying 3,303ft.lb of force.

What size primer does a 300 win mag take?

Which Federal Primer for 300 Win Mag? Federal 215, which is the large rifle magnum primer, or the Federal 210, which is the regular large rifle primer, depending on what your gun likes. You can also get their match large rifle magnums or match large rifles.

What’s better 30-06 or 300 Win Mag?

300 Win Mag has over 35% more case capacity than the 30-06, allowing for larger powder charges and higher velocity that lends itself to long-range shooting. As far as pressure, the . 300 Win Mag is capable of handling over 3,000 psi more pressure than the 30-06.

Which is better 300 Win Mag or 6.5 Creedmoor?

300 Win Mag fires larger diameter and significantly heavier bullets at a higher velocity than the 6.5 Creedmoor. The . 300 Win Mag has a flatter trajectory and has significantly more kinetic energy at typical hunting ranges, but the 6.5 Creedmoor has much less recoil.

How far should you sight in a 300 win mag?

300 Winchester’s bullet will be about 3 inches below the line of sight at 250 yards. So from zero to 250 yards the bullet is never more than 1.86 inches above or 3 inches below the line of sight. On big game this means you can hold on the center of the chest and you will hit the kill zone if you do your job.
